9 Fun Spring Cleaning Tips for Your Website!

Here’s your official Spring Cleaning Checklist to freshen things up and get your store back to boss status:

1. Refresh Your Homepage 💻

  • Swap in a spring-themed banner or header
  • Highlight your current faves or new arrivals
  • Remove any expired promos or old announcements

2. Clean Up Those Product Listings 🧼

  • Delete products that are sold out or no longer serving you
  • Update descriptions with fresh keywords and fun energy
  • Add lifestyle mockups that scream ✨ BUY ME ✨

3. Reorganize Your Collections 💐

  • Create cute seasonal collections (Spring Vibes, Grad Gifts, Mother's Day Must-Haves)
  • Merge or remove underperforming ones

4. Freshen Up Your Copy 📝

  • Update your “About” page with more YOU
  • Add fresh testimonials and customer love notes 💕
  • Make sure your policies and contact info are current

5. Test Your Links & Buttons 🔗

  • Click through your menus and checkout process
  • Fix anything that’s broken or slow
  • Test your mobile view (because most of your customers are scrolling on phones!) 📱

6. Audit Your Policies 📋

  • Make sure your shipping, return, and privacy info is clear and easy to find
  • Add or update your FAQs for repeat questions

7. Give Your Branding a Glow-Up ✨

  • Update fonts, colors, or layouts to reflect your spring aesthetic
  • Add a seasonal popup or promo bar 🌷
  • Match your visuals to your energy — clean, cute, and confident!

8. Revisit Your Email Game 💌

  • Create a new lead magnet (think: spring sale or freebie)
  • Update your welcome email series to reflect your current voice + vibe
  • Make sure your email form is WORKING (you’d be surprised 👀)

9. Backup Your Site + Update That Theme 🛠️

  • Run a quick backup before editing your site
  • Check for a Shopify theme update — they often come with helpful new features
  • Remove old apps you’re no longer using (hello faster load time!)
